This property, located on the West Side of Madison near Verona was roughly 40 years old with a 6 month old addition. Renovated homes like this can cause some very tricky mitigation problems which is why it’s paramount to use a Licensed Radon Reduction Contractor that is not only experienced and knowledgeable, but extremely thorough when planning out your Radon Mitigation System Installation project.

Challenging Radon Mitigation System Installation Madison, Wisconsin



So when it came to this home in particular, our Mitigation System Installers knew right away that the footing between the addition and the original house could cause air flow issues beneath the concrete slab. Without your Radon Company properly addressing and planing for these factors you’ll end up with a half functional Radon Mitigation System that’s not properly drawing out the dangerous Radon Gas that exists in many of The Greater Madison Area homes. RADON GAS TESTING & MITIGATION QUESTION OF THE DAY:


How big are Radon Pipes?
In our experience most radon vent pipes are typically 3″ or 4″ inside diameter PVC piping. Four inch pipe can easily move 150 cfm of air while three inch pipe can move 80 cfm.  Many homes here in Madison can be fixed using only three inch pipes but four inch allows a margin of safety if more air needs to be moved through the system.  Sometimes smaller 2″ or even 1.5″ pipes are used to draw small amounts of air out from under a membrane or a block wall.
